Teljes leírás

In accordance with the literary ideals of Munshi Premchand, the stories of Pandit Janardan Rai Nagar are marked by brevity, engaging beginnings, compelling development, and thought-provoking conclusions. A distinctive feature of his stories is that they are written with a focus on everyday life and social conduct. They are deeply rooted in the realities of the society and culture of their time. Unlike contemporary narratives, these stories portray Indian society in the period following 1900 CE. The plots of all the stories emerge from experiences drawn from home, family, neighborhoods, workplaces, and friendships. Often, a simple incident or idea served as the seed, and Nagar Ji's imagination transformed it into a complete story. Such creativity reflects the fact that his emotions, perception, and awareness remained open, observant, and alert to the world around him. Through the creation of more than 100 stories, he made a significant contribution to enriching Hindi literature. His works were published for many years in renowned literary magazines such as Saraswati, Madhuri, Sudha, Hans, Chand, and Veena.

Through this book, readers will not only gain insight into the society of that era but will also have the opportunity to journey through the golden age of storytelling associated with Munshi Premchand.
